VOXX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

112 of the 3,448 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in VOXX International Corporation Class A (VOXX)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$151M — up 3.1% from $146M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 14 funds closed out of VOXX and 12 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 41 trimmed existing stakes and 35 added.

The largest buyer was First Wilshire Securities Management, adding an estimated $4.97M. The largest seller was Putnam Investments, cutting an estimated $5.74M.
